PAHRUMP, Nev. (AP) - Former "Hollywood Madam" Heidi Fleiss has
pleaded guilty to felony drug charges in Nevada, but will avoid a return trip to prison.
Nye County District Attorney Bob Beckett says Fleiss faces up to five years' probation after pleading guilty Tuesday to unlawful use of methamphetamine and possession of the painkiller hydrocodone without a prescription.
Fleiss declined comment to the Las Vegas Review-Journal. Sentencing is scheduled Sept. 15.
The charges stem from an arrest Feb. 7, 2008, outside a plumbing supply store in rural Pahrump, 60 miles west of Las Vegas.
Fleiss is 43. Beckett says if she successfully completesprobation, the two felony convictions will be erased from her record.
Fleiss moved to Nevada after serving prison time in California for running a prostitution ring.
